Muscles aching day. Hahaha. A day after our hike, today we will be going for Padas White Water Rafting. It is a class 3-4 water rafting and I am very excited about it. We started our journey at 7.30am, and it takes us 2 hours to get to a stop for some food. Then we continue our journey to a place, where we wore the safety helmet plus the life jacket. We were than seated on a piece of square wood, and 3-4 people can be seated on it. It is then put on the train railway and we will be pushed by the men using a stick, just like how we operate a skateboard. After we were all seated in a row on the railway, all of a sudden the men told us to get up. I wasn’t sure why at that point of time, but it was because the train is coming towards us. That was a very hilarious moment as I can see the train, which is moving pretty slowly coming from behind. The men then moved away all the wooden seats and allow the train to move on first. We then seated on the wood again and two men stand on our wood, one leg on the floor, another leg on our seat, and with a stick, they push us like pushing cart. It was a new experience for me. I did enjoy it, but the trip is 45 minutes and my butt was kinda hurt at the end of the trip.

We were brought to a station where we were briefed about water rafting, and the safety steps to take consideration into. And now we are all ready to rock and roll! All I can say is water rafting is seriously fun. It’s a must try =D
Water Rafting = Fun, fun, fun!!
Look at the obstacles! Luckily we have an experienced guide behind us who helped us to navigate our way through.
